    there are 10 groups of 10 weights.
    (so there are 100 weights as a sum)
    each weight in 9 of these groups
    have weight of 100 grams.
    and one of these groups,
    contain weights each of 90 grams.

    how can we identify which group
    of the 10 groups is the one which
    has 90grams weights,
    BY WEIGHING ONLY ONCE.
